Add 15/60 and 12/90
15/60 + 12/90 is 23/60.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 60 and 90 is 180
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 180 - For the 1st fraction, since 60 × 3 = 180,
15/60 = 15 × 3/60 × 3 = 45/180 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 90 × 2 = 180,
12/90 = 12 × 2/90 × 2 = 24/180 - Add the two like fractions:
45/180 + 24/180 = 45 + 24/180 = 69/180 - 69/180 simplified gives 23/60
- So, 15/60 + 12/90 = 23/60
